Some quotes: If, however, the Ego is constituted by such a dualistic way of thinking, it means that an Ego can die without physical death and without consciousness coming to an end. What makes this more than idle speculation is that there is ample testimony to the possibility of such Ego death: No one gets so much of God as the man who is completely dead. (St. Gregory) The Kingdom of God is for none but the thoroughly dead. (Eckhart Tolle) We are in a world of generation and death, and this world we must cast off. (William Blake) Your glory lies where you cease to exist.
